  • Patent number: 9481515
    Abstract: Certain embodiments of a trash can include a cap with a lid and an actuator. The actuator can extend outwardly from the cap at a downward angle. The actuator can be configured to maintain the lid in a closed position when a locking portion of the actuator is engaged with a securement portion of the lid. The lid can be rotationally biased toward an open position and the actuator can be configured to release the lid from the closed position upon an input of force on the actuator. The range of effective angles for the input force can enable a user of the trash can to easily open the lid by contacting the actuator with from a wide variety of angles.

  • Patent number: 8747933
    Abstract: A can cooker includes a main body that is generally cylindrical in shape having a bottom portion, wall portion, neck portion, and lid ring. The bottom portion, wall portion, and neck portion may be integrally formed and connected to one another. A lid is sized and shaped to fit within a part of the neck portion. The lid includes an outer lip that engaged with lid ring on the main body in such a way that a seal is formed between the lid ring and the outer lip. The lid is secured to the main body through a plurality of latches. Handles may be placed on the exterior surface of the lid and main body to ease use and transportation of the can cooker.

  • Publication number: 20080228134
    Abstract: Methods for storing human breast milk, preserving its natural flavor and nutritional content. Through the use of an apparatus such as a breast pump, breast milk is expressed from a lactating woman. The milk is transferred through a fill line into a storage container. After the container is substantially filled with breast milk, the fill line is decoupled from the breast pump output, and a vacuum is applied to the line. After the remaining air is evacuated from the container, an isolation valve in the fill line is closed, sealing the container in an evacuated condition. The fill line is removed from the valve, and the container is placed into a freezer or refrigerator for storage. When ready for use, the container is removed from the freezer or refrigerator, the milk is thawed, and the vacuum is broken, allowing removal of the milk for transfer to a bottle.

  • Patent number: 5447762
    Abstract: A method and system are disclosed for locally introducing fluid, such as a gas, at a predetermined location into molten resin downstream from a resin injection aperture to form a hollow part. The gas is utilized at the localized area to distribute the molten resin, to eliminated molded in stress and to prevent formation of sink marks in the part during resin solidification. An overflow reservoir outside of the mold cavity is filled with the resin during resin injection and then the gas is introduced into the reservoir through a fluid aperture and into the part. The reservoir creates a cocoon of solidified material to act as a seal to prevent gas leakage. One hollow body formed by the method and system includes a substantially endless hollow body portion with a fluid opening for communicating the interior of the hollow body portion with the locally introduced fluid. The hollow body provides an internal gas manifold and means for greater structural integrity.
